Verizon receives 2024 ENERGY STAR Award for 12th consecutive year

NEW YORK, April 26,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ency has recognized Verizon Communications Inc. (NYSE, Nasdaq: VZ) as a recipient of the 2024 ENERGY STAR® Partner of the Year – Sustained Excellence Award in the Energy Management category. This marks the 12th consecutive year that Verizon has been recognized by ENERGY STAR® for its ongoing leadership in protecting the environment through its numerous energy efficient milestones and achievements.

Verizon has achieved 677 ENERGY STAR certifications for its properties since 2001 and will continue to pursue ENERGY STAR certifications for 100% of its eligible facilities. Verizon is actively reducing energy use across its networks, data centers and building portfolio. By migrating copper-based services to fiber technologies, implementing energy-saving practices such as free cooling to our data centers, and upgrading to LED lights in our administrative buildings, Verizon is focused on maximizing energy efficiency.

As recently announced, Verizon joined RE100, a global initiative bringing together the world’s most influential businesses committed to 100% renewable electricity. Aiming to source renewable energy equivalent to 100% of its annual electricity usage by 2030, with an interim target of 50% by 2025, the move to join RE100 aligned with the company’s long-standing commitment to drive environmental and social progress as part of its responsible business plan, Citizen Verizon. As part of our renewable energy purchase program, Verizon has entered into 27 REPAs for a total of approximately 3.6 gigawatts (GW) of anticipated renewable energy generating capacity.

Each year, the ENERGY STAR® Awards honor a group of businesses and organizations that have made outstanding contributions to protecting the environment through superior energy efficiency achievements. Winners include businesses, organizations, and innovators that drive the adoption of energy-efficient products, services, and strategies crucial for reducing emissions and creating a healthy environment. Verizon was honored for its long-term commitment to energy efficiency and accomplishments in Washington, D.C., on April 25, 2024.
